Commission approves Sinclair, Mediacom carriage agreement

The FCC’s Media Bureau has given its OK to Sinclair Broadcasting’s dealings with cable operator Mediacom. The agency last week denied a retransmission consent complaint by Mediacom, allowing as many as 800,000 cable viewers in the Des Moines and Cedar Rapids, IA, markets to lose Sinclair’s programming.

According to the FCC in its denial of the complaint, Mediacom said Sinclair was engaging in good faith dealings for retransmission consent.
